32 Degrees Heated Vest

32 degrees heated vest

Price: $49.99

Stay warm this season. Whether you're taking a walk around town, going on a holiday outdoor adventure, or just want to keep the winter chill at bay, this rechargeable heated vest is an affordable option. Features include three settings, front and back heated panels, and a lightweight design.

Copper Fit Compression Socks

copper fit compression socks

Price: $21.99

If foot or leg circulation, pain, and swelling are issues, pick up a two-pack of these comfortable, cushioned compression socks before the month ends. This deal is a steal for $21.99. A single pair from the same brand costs $18.79 at CVS.

Starbucks Holiday Blend Coffee Pods

holiday blend coffee pods

Price: $44.99

Snag this seasonal deal while you can. The 72-serving box of Holiday Blend K-Cups is an affordable alternative to barista blends.

A single grande Christmas Blonde coffee is $2.95 (plus tax and a tip) in Starbucks' cafes. At that price, seventy-two cups would cost you over $200.
